Ceratosaurus is figure #149, from Series 6: the Dinosaurs. It had a point-value of 150, and was re-released in the Secret Skeleton Dinosaurs subseries. Apart from the stance, with the creature leaning on its coiled tail, the figurine is a reasonably accurate portrayal of the genus.

Ceratosaurus meaning "horned lizard", was a large predatory theropod dinosaur from the Late Jurassic Period, found in the Morrison Formation of North America, in Tanzania and Portugal. It was characterized by large jaws with blade-like teeth, a large, blade-like horn on the snout and a pair of hornlets over the eyes. The forelimbs were powerfully built but very short. A row of small osteoderms (bony nodules) was present down the middle of the back, providing some armor -- a trait unique among the theropods. Ceratosaurus was an active predator, and its teeth marks have been found in the remains of contemporary dinosaurs.

Ceratosaurus is a fairly popular dinosaur due to its unusual facial features. It has appeared in several movies, including the first live action film to feature dinosaurs -- Brute Force (1914); Fantasia (1940), in which one battles a Stegosaurus; One Million Years BC (1966), in which it battles a Triceratops; The Land That Time Forgot (1975) where it also battles a Triceratops, and its sequel The People That Time Forgot (1977) in which a character rescues a cave-girl from two pursuing Ceratosaurus; and briefly in Jurassic Park III in which it is repelled from attacking the main characters by a large mound of Spinosaurus dung.
